BBRSpeedWorks 10-28-2015 02:24 PM

Yes a stock car that wheel hops everywhere will brake axles. If u do stiff *** bushings in the back with stiff springs then u can eliminate as much wheel hop as possible and the axles will last longer..or just get traction. Wheel hop killer on our cars and it kills axles..our axles are pretty stout for a factory axle.
